Max Verstappen’s Father Warns of Potential Red Bull Disruption with Horner’s Continuation
Red Bull Racing is facing internal divisions and potential disruption as Max Verstappen’s father, Jos Verstappen, warns that the team is at risk of being torn apart if Christian Horner remains in charge. The ongoing controversy surrounding the team principal has put Red Bull Racing in the spotlight during the start of the new Formula One season.
Fractures within the team became public in early February when Red Bull GmbH announced an investigation into allegations of inappropriate behavior against Horner. The parent company took these allegations seriously and conducted the investigation with an outside party. However, the investigation was dismissed, and the complainant was given the right to appeal. Soon after, a cache of messages allegedly between Horner and the female complainant was anonymously leaked to F1 officials and the media.
In an interview with the Daily Mail, Jos Verstappen expressed his concerns about the situation, stating that there is tension within the team while Horner remains in his position. He believes that the team is in danger of being torn apart and that it cannot continue the way it is. Jos Verstappen has been actively involved in his son’s racing career and has a close relationship with him, which gives him a certain degree of influence within the team.
Horner has not publicly commented on the leaked messages, and Red Bull Racing spokesperson dismissed any issues within the team, stating that they are united and focused on racing. However, tensions between Jos Verstappen and Horner have escalated, putting the father of the star driver in opposition to the team principal.
The tensions within Red Bull Racing have been growing since the death of Red Bull co-founder Dietrich Mateschitz in October 2022. Mateschitz was the leader of the company’s F1 efforts, and his absence has led to increased friction between senior figures within the company.
Despite the controversy, Max Verstappen has maintained his focus on the track and his preparations for the new season. He has expressed full faith in Horner’s leadership and praised him as an incredible team boss. Verstappen’s contract with Red Bull runs until 2028, but his father’s comments raise questions about the dynamic between Verstappen and Horner moving forward.
The nature of the tension at Red Bull has also sparked speculation about Verstappen potentially driving for Mercedes in the future. However, Mercedes team boss Toto Wolff believes that a driver will always choose the quickest car, and currently, Red Bull is the fastest team in Formula One.
